91欧美超碰AV自拍|国产成年人性爱视频免费看|亚洲 日韩 欧美一厂二区入|人人看人人爽人人操aV|丝袜美腿视频一区二区在线看|人人操人人爽人人爱|婷婷五月天超碰|97色色欧美亚州A√|另类A√无码精品一级av|欧美特级日韩特级

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

探索Microchip dsPIC30F系列數(shù)字信號控制器:高性能與多功能的完美融合

chencui ? 2026-04-07 11:35 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

探索Microchip dsPIC30F系列數(shù)字信號控制器:高性能與多功能的完美融合

電子工程師的工具箱中,數(shù)字信號控制器(DSC)是處理復(fù)雜信號處理和控制任務(wù)的關(guān)鍵工具。Microchip的dsPIC30F2011/2012/3012/3013系列DSC,憑借其高性能和豐富的功能,成為了眾多工程師的首選。今天,我們就來深入了解一下這款強大的DSC。

文件下載:DSPIC30F2011T-30I/SO.pdf

一、產(chǎn)品概述

Microchip的dsPIC30F2011/2012/3012/3013系列DSC,將數(shù)字信號處理器(DSP)的強大功能集成到高性能16位微控制器MCU)架構(gòu)中。這意味著它不僅能夠處理復(fù)雜的數(shù)字信號處理任務(wù),還具備微控制器的靈活性和易用性。

需要注意的是,這份數(shù)據(jù)手冊只是對該系列設(shè)備特性的總結(jié),并非完整的參考資料。若要獲取關(guān)于CPU、外設(shè)、寄存器描述和設(shè)備一般功能的更多信息,可參考《dsPIC30F Family Reference Manual》(DS70046);若要了解設(shè)備指令集和編程方面的更多內(nèi)容,可參考《16-bit MCU and DSC Programmer’s Reference Manual》(DS70157)。

二、CPU架構(gòu)

2.1 核心概述

dsPIC30F的核心采用24位指令字,程序計數(shù)器(PC)為23位寬,最低有效位(LSb)始終為0。在正常程序執(zhí)行期間,最高有效位(MSb)通常被忽略,但某些特殊指令除外。這使得PC能夠?qū)ぶ范噙_(dá)4M個指令字的用戶程序空間。

工作寄存器陣列由16個16位寄存器組成,每個寄存器都可以作為數(shù)據(jù)、地址或偏移寄存器使用。其中一個工作寄存器(W15)用作中斷和調(diào)用的軟件堆棧指針。數(shù)據(jù)空間為64 Kbytes(32K字),分為X和Y兩個數(shù)據(jù)存儲塊,每個塊都有自己獨立的地址生成單元(AGU)。

2.2 數(shù)據(jù)訪問方式

在數(shù)據(jù)訪問方面,有兩種方式可以訪問程序存儲器中的數(shù)據(jù)。一種是通過8位程序空間可見頁寄存器(PSVPAG),將數(shù)據(jù)空間內(nèi)存的上32 Kbytes映射到程序空間的下半部分(用戶空間)的任意16K程序字邊界。這樣,任何指令都可以像訪問數(shù)據(jù)空間一樣訪問程序空間,但訪問需要額外的周期,且只能訪問每個指令字的低16位。另一種是使用任何工作寄存器,通過表讀寫指令對程序空間內(nèi)的32K字頁面進(jìn)行線性間接訪問,這種方式可以訪問指令字的所有24位。

2.3 尋址模式與DSP引擎

該核心支持多種尋址模式,包括固有(無操作數(shù))、相對、字面量、內(nèi)存直接、寄存器直接、寄存器間接、寄存器偏移和字面量偏移尋址模式。大多數(shù)指令能夠在每個指令周期內(nèi)執(zhí)行數(shù)據(jù)(或程序數(shù)據(jù))存儲器讀取、工作寄存器(數(shù)據(jù))讀取、數(shù)據(jù)存儲器寫入和程序(指令)存儲器讀取操作,從而支持3操作數(shù)指令,實現(xiàn)C = A + B的操作在單個周期內(nèi)完成。

此外,該核心還集成了一個DSP引擎,顯著增強了核心的算術(shù)能力和吞吐量。它具有一個高速17位乘17位乘法器、一個40位ALU、兩個40位飽和累加器和一個40位雙向桶形移位器。累加器或任何工作寄存器中的數(shù)據(jù)可以在單個周期內(nèi)右移最多15位或左移最多16位。

三、主要特性

3.1 高性能RISC CPU

  • 架構(gòu)與指令集:采用改進(jìn)的哈佛架構(gòu),C編譯器優(yōu)化的指令集架構(gòu),具有靈活的尋址模式和83條基本指令。24位寬的指令和16位寬的數(shù)據(jù)路徑,提供了高效的處理能力。
  • 存儲與運行速度:擁有高達(dá)24 Kbytes的片上閃存程序空間、2 Kbytes的片上數(shù)據(jù)RAM和1 Kbytes的非易失性數(shù)據(jù)EEPROM。最高可實現(xiàn)30 MIPS的操作速度,支持DC至40 MHz的外部時鐘輸入,以及4 MHz - 10 MHz的振蕩器輸入(PLL激活時為4x、8x、16x)。
  • 中斷處理:具備多達(dá)21個中斷源,8個用戶可選的優(yōu)先級級別,3個外部中斷源和4個處理器陷阱源,能夠快速響應(yīng)各種事件。

3.2 DSP特性

  • 數(shù)據(jù)處理:支持雙數(shù)據(jù)提取、模和位反轉(zhuǎn)模式,擁有兩個40位寬的累加器和可選的飽和邏輯,以及17位x 17位單周期硬件分?jǐn)?shù)/整數(shù)乘法器。所有DSP指令均為單周期執(zhí)行,支持乘法累加(MAC)操作和單周期±16移位。

3.3 外設(shè)特性

  • I/O引腳:具有高電流灌/拉I/O引腳,可提供25 mA/25 mA的電流。
  • 定時器與計數(shù)器:擁有三個16位定時器/計數(shù)器,可選擇將16位定時器配對成32位定時器模塊。
  • 輸入輸出功能:具備16位捕獲輸入功能和16位比較/PWM輸出功能。
  • 通信模塊:支持3線SPI模塊(支持四種幀模式)、I2C?模塊(支持多主/從模式和7位/10位尋址),以及多達(dá)兩個可尋址的UART模塊(帶有FIFO緩沖區(qū))。

3.4 模擬特性

  • ADC轉(zhuǎn)換:配備12位模擬-to-數(shù)字轉(zhuǎn)換器ADC),轉(zhuǎn)換速率為200 ksps,最多支持10個輸入通道,并且在睡眠和空閑模式下也可進(jìn)行轉(zhuǎn)換。
  • 電壓檢測與復(fù)位:具有可編程低電壓檢測(PLVD)和可編程欠壓復(fù)位功能,確保系統(tǒng)在不同電壓條件下的穩(wěn)定運行。

3.5 特殊微控制器特性

  • 存儲器性能:增強的閃存程序存儲器在工業(yè)溫度范圍內(nèi)至少有10,000次擦除/寫入周期(典型值為100K),數(shù)據(jù)EEPROM存儲器在工業(yè)溫度范圍內(nèi)至少有100,000次擦除/寫入周期(典型值為1M)。
  • 自我編程與復(fù)位:支持軟件控制下的自我重新編程,具備上電復(fù)位(POR)、上電定時器(PWRT)和振蕩器啟動定時器(OST),以及靈活的看門狗定時器(WDT),確保系統(tǒng)的可靠運行。
  • 時鐘監(jiān)控與保護:具備故障安全時鐘監(jiān)控功能,可檢測時鐘故障并切換到片上低功耗RC振蕩器。同時,支持可編程代碼保護和在線串行編程(ICSP?),并提供可選的電源管理模式,如睡眠、空閑和備用時鐘模式。

四、不同型號對比

設(shè)備 引腳 程序存儲器(字節(jié)) 程序存儲器(指令) SRAM字節(jié) EEPROM字節(jié) 16位定時器 輸入捕獲 輸出比較/標(biāo)準(zhǔn)PWM 12位A/D 200 Ksps UART SPI I2C?
dsPIC30F2011 18 12K 4K 1024 3 2 2 8 ch 1 1 1
dsPIC30F3012 18 24K 8K 2048 1024 3 2 2 8 ch 1 1 1
dsPIC30F2012 28 12K 4K 1024 3 2 2 10 ch 1 1 1
dsPIC30F3013 28 24K 8K 2048 1024 3 2 2 10 ch 2 1 1

從表格中可以看出,不同型號在引腳數(shù)量、程序存儲器大小、SRAM和EEPROM容量等方面存在差異。工程師可以根據(jù)具體的應(yīng)用需求選擇合適的型號。

五、代碼保護與質(zhì)量認(rèn)證

5.1 代碼保護

Microchip認(rèn)為其產(chǎn)品系列在市場上是最安全的系列之一,但也存在一些不誠實甚至非法的方法來破解代碼保護功能。不過,這些方法通常需要在Microchip數(shù)據(jù)手冊規(guī)定的操作規(guī)格之外使用產(chǎn)品。Microchip愿意與關(guān)注代碼完整性的客戶合作,但無法保證代碼的絕對安全。代碼保護功能在不斷發(fā)展,Microchip致力于持續(xù)改進(jìn)產(chǎn)品的代碼保護特性。

5.2 質(zhì)量認(rèn)證

Microchip的全球總部、位于亞利桑那州錢德勒和坦佩、俄勒岡州格雷舍姆的設(shè)計和晶圓制造設(shè)施,以及加利福尼亞州和印度的設(shè)計中心均獲得了ISO/TS - 16949:2002認(rèn)證。公司的質(zhì)量體系流程和程序適用于其PIC? MCU和dsPIC? DSC、KEELOQ?代碼跳變設(shè)備、串行EEPROM、微外設(shè)、非易失性存儲器和模擬產(chǎn)品。此外,Microchip的開發(fā)系統(tǒng)設(shè)計和制造質(zhì)量體系通過了ISO 9001:2000認(rèn)證。

六、總結(jié)

Microchip的dsPIC30F2011/2012/3012/3013系列DSC以其高性能的CPU架構(gòu)、豐富的外設(shè)功能和可靠的代碼保護機制,為電子工程師提供了一個強大而靈活的解決方案。無論是在工業(yè)控制、通信、消費電子還是其他領(lǐng)域,這些DSC都能夠滿足各種復(fù)雜的應(yīng)用需求。

在實際應(yīng)用中,工程師們需要根據(jù)具體的項目需求,仔細(xì)選擇合適的型號,并充分利用其特性來實現(xiàn)高效、穩(wěn)定的系統(tǒng)設(shè)計。那么,你在使用類似的DSC時遇到過哪些挑戰(zhàn)呢?又是如何解決的呢?歡迎在評論區(qū)分享你的經(jīng)驗和見解。

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• microchip
    +關(guān)注

    關(guān)注

    53

    文章

    1658

    瀏覽量

    121059
  • dsPIC30F
    +關(guān)注

    關(guān)注

    1

    文章

    71

    瀏覽量

    24489
  • 數(shù)字信號控制器

    關(guān)注

    0

    文章

    97

    瀏覽量

    13850
收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評論

    相關(guān)推薦
    熱點推薦

    dsPIC33FJ系列16位數(shù)字信號控制器:特性與應(yīng)用解析

    dsPIC33FJ系列16位數(shù)字信號控制器:特性與應(yīng)用解析 在電子設(shè)計領(lǐng)域,數(shù)字信號控制器(DS
    的頭像 發(fā)表于 04-07 17:15 ?138次閱讀

    探索 dsPIC33EPXXXGM3XX/6XX/7XX 16 位數(shù)字信號控制器

    探索 dsPIC33EPXXXGM3XX/6XX/7XX 16 位數(shù)字信號控制器 在電子設(shè)計領(lǐng)域,一款性能卓越的
    的頭像 發(fā)表于 04-07 16:55 ?163次閱讀

    深入解析Microchip dsPIC30F4011/4012數(shù)字信號控制器

    4011/4012就是這樣一款高性能的16位數(shù)字信號控制器,它融合了強大的數(shù)字信號處理(DSP)功能與
    的頭像 發(fā)表于 04-07 16:50 ?169次閱讀

    探索Microchip dsPIC30F3010/3011:高性能16位數(shù)字信號控制器

    探索Microchip dsPIC30F3010/3011:高性能16位數(shù)字信號控制器 在電子設(shè)
    的頭像 發(fā)表于 04-07 16:50 ?172次閱讀

    dsPIC30F6011/6012/6013/6014數(shù)字信號控制器高性能與多功能完美結(jié)合

    dsPIC30F6011/6012/6013/6014數(shù)字信號控制器高性能與多功能完美結(jié)合
    的頭像 發(fā)表于 04-07 11:35 ?94次閱讀

    dsPIC30F6011/6012/6013/6014數(shù)字信號控制器功能與特性解析

    dsPIC30F6011/6012/6013/6014數(shù)字信號控制器功能與特性解析 在電子設(shè)計領(lǐng)域,高性能
    的頭像 發(fā)表于 04-07 11:35 ?101次閱讀

    深入剖析 dsPIC33FJ 系列數(shù)字信號控制器

    33FJ128GP804-I/ML.pdf 一、整體概述 dsPIC33F 系列設(shè)備將強大的數(shù)字信號處理(DSP)功能與
    的頭像 發(fā)表于 04-07 11:25 ?100次閱讀

    dsPIC33EPXXXGM3XX/6XX/7XX數(shù)字信號控制器高性能與多功能完美結(jié)合

    dsPIC33EPXXXGM3XX/6XX/7XX數(shù)字信號控制器高性能與多功能完美結(jié)合 在電
    的頭像 發(fā)表于 04-07 11:05 ?59次閱讀

    探索Microchip dsPIC33FJ12GP201/202:高性能16位數(shù)字信號控制器

    探索Microchip dsPIC33FJ12GP201/202:高性能16位數(shù)字信號控制器
    的頭像 發(fā)表于 04-07 11:00 ?49次閱讀

    深入解析 dsPIC33FJ 系列 16 位數(shù)字信號控制器

    深入解析 dsPIC33FJ 系列 16 位數(shù)字信號控制器 在電子工程師的日常項目中,選擇一款合適的數(shù)字信號
    的頭像 發(fā)表于 04-07 10:55 ?25次閱讀

    dsPIC30F6010:高性能16位數(shù)字信號控制器的技術(shù)剖析

    控制器,它將強大的數(shù)字信號處理(DSP)功能集成在高性能16位微控制器(MCU)架構(gòu)中。不過,這份數(shù)據(jù)手冊只是對
    的頭像 發(fā)表于 04-07 09:30 ?50次閱讀

    dsPIC30F系列數(shù)字信號控制器編程規(guī)范詳解

    dsPIC30F系列數(shù)字信號控制器編程規(guī)范詳解 在電子工程領(lǐng)域,數(shù)字信號控制器(DSCs)的應(yīng)用
    的頭像 發(fā)表于 04-06 16:45 ?997次閱讀

    Infineon XC228x微控制器高性能與多功能完美融合

    Infineon XC228x微控制器高性能與多功能完美融合 在當(dāng)今電子技術(shù)飛速發(fā)展的時代,微控制器
    的頭像 發(fā)表于 03-30 16:35 ?111次閱讀

    ADSP-CM40xF系列混合信號控制處理高性能與多功能完美融合

    ADSP-CM40xF系列混合信號控制處理高性能與多功能
    的頭像 發(fā)表于 03-24 09:15 ?425次閱讀

    使用 dsPIC30F 實現(xiàn) BLDC 電機的正弦電壓驅(qū)動

    簡介 在 BLDC 電機應(yīng)用中,由于存在噪音和轉(zhuǎn)矩脈動問題,使用三相正弦波電壓代替六拍電壓是一種理想的控制方法。本文檔介紹的應(yīng)用軟件利用 dsPIC30F 數(shù)字信號控制器高效且可靠地實
    發(fā)表于 05-14 15:56